Corporal James Leroy Duggan

56, Truro, passed away peacefully at home in the presence of his loving family on Saturday, June 14, 2008 after a courageous battle with cancer. Jim "Leroy" was born on April 2, 1952 in Antigonish,N.S. He joined the RCMP in April 1973 and spent his 35 years of service in Newfoundland and Nova Scotia. He was an avid outdoorsman enjoying hunting, ski-dooing and motorcycling to name a few. Also, a sports enthusiast, who enjoyed playing and coaching hockey for many years. Most of all he was a wonderful husband and father. Forever loved, remembered and truly missed by his wife, Carolyn; daughter, Kimberley and his son, Neil (Sonya); parents, James and Effie; brother, Michael (Beryl); sisters, Sheila Dwyer, Peggy (Max), Joan Rule (Brad) and Annette; numerous nephews, nieces, extended family as well as a large circle of friends.
